So, RCBS recently released the ChargeMaster Link, which is a improved version of the Lite. It looks like they're also about to release the ChargeMaster Supreme. I already have the Lite, so more interested in the Supreme. It boasts a faster throw, powder-learning, and some other nice-to-haves.

Does anyone have thoughts on this one? It seems like a good step up, but hard to say without seeing hands-on demo/review videos. Also wondering if it'd be better to wait the long wait for the AT v4 setup.
 
The powder learning may be useful, but I don't see much point to the bluetooth. It's necessary for the AT, but the CM has all the appropriate buttons on the front.

If you're diving down the precision rabbit hole, all roads still lead to AT in my mind. If you're after convenience or really need to hit a price point, this should make the older chargemasters a little cheaper on the secondary market for a bit.
